    Important Features of Collapsible Mobility Scooters

    veleco-faster-lit-ion-4-wheeled-mobility-scooter-fully-assembled-and-ready-to-use-removeable-lithium-ion-battery-safe-and-stable-alarm-spacious-storage-cupholder-black-1159.jpgA collapsible wheelchair can help to get around when you require assistance. They fold and unfold quickly, and be tucked away in the trunk of a car without requiring disassembly.

    There are a variety of sizes and forms of scooters and scooters, so it is important to consider your needs before buying. These scooters will allow you to travel more easily, increase your independence, and allow you to get more accomplished throughout the day.

    Capacity to bear weight

    The capacity to support weight of a collapsible scooter determines whether it is easy to use and comfortable to transport. Additionally, the weight of the device will affect its speed as well as its maximum climbing angle.

    To ensure a stable and safe ride the scooter's weight must be within the manufacturer's recommended weight limit. If you exceed the limit, it can significantly reduce the operational speed and decrease the range of travel, and could even cause damage the suspension and batteries.

    Lightweight, folding scooters are a popular choice for people who require a mobility aid that's easy to carry and fold. Some models fold with the press of a button while others require users to manually fold the scooter manually.

    Many collapsible scooters can be found in both three-wheel and four-wheel options. Four-wheel scooters tend to have larger wheelbases and provide more stability than their three-wheel counterparts. They also tend to have more legroom and more roomy seats, which can be helpful for heavier riders.

    Turning radius

    When looking for mobility equipment the radius of turning is an important feature to consider. The smaller the turning radius, the better for maneuvering narrow hallways and other spaces.

    A scooter with a tight turning radius is also safer to use than one with a greater turning radius. This is due to the fact that it's easier to maneuver around obstacles and through tighter spaces.

    There are a variety of factors to take into consideration when choosing an item with an extremely tight turning radius, depending on your personal preferences and medical needs. Consult a mobility expert at Scootaround to determine the device that's best mobility scooter for car boot for you.

    The smaller the turning radius the more easy it is to maneuver around the midst of a crowd and in smaller spaces such as hallways. These vehicles will also come with advanced brake systems that are vital for security in these areas.

    Some collapsible scooters feature the four-wheel model, which reduces the radius of turning to 32 inches. This makes them more nimble than their 3-wheel counterparts, and provides plenty of stability. They are also easy to fold and store when not in use.

    Braking system

    The brake system on collapsible mobility scooters plays crucially in preventing accidents. A reliable braking system will assist you in stopping quickly if you have to avoid traffic or if you need to reach your destination quicker.

    The braking system of a scooter must be easy to operate, durable and effective. It should be able handle various types of terrain.

    Disc brakes are the most popular type of braking system on electric scooters, and they are reliable, efficient, and cost-effective. They aren't as effective on wet or rough surfaces.

    A disc brake is comprised of a metal rotor, and calipers, which press on the rotor to cause friction when you press the brake lever. They are known for being effective, inexpensive and simple to adjust.

    Some electric scooters use disc and hydraulic brakes. This makes them more stabile and avoids feeling the brakes only one side.

    Regenerative braking is another brake system that is used on certain mobility devices. This is the system for braking that automatically recharges your battery whenever you slow down.

    Ground clearance

    If you live in an area that has a lot of rough terrain or must traverse over curbs and bumps consider a scooter with better ground clearance. This is crucial to avoid getting stuck in areas with limited space or even if you encounter an entrance threshold that may not be easy to get over. It also helps if your mobility scooter comes with full suspension that minimizes the amount of bumps you feel on your ride.

    pride-apex-epic-4-wheeled-mobility-scooter-pearl-white-1117.jpgScooters have the ability to travel on ground from 1.5 to 4.5 inches, depending on the model and manufacturer. This is enough to prevent you from getting stuck, however when you plan to drive on rough terrains such as dirt, grass or gravel, then you'll need a model that has greater ground clearance. Four-wheeled scooters are better suited for outdoor use, as they can maneuver over rough terrain more easily than models that are portable or travel. They also have larger wheels which allow for easier maneuvering over obstacles that are large and pneumatic tires, which increase the traction and reduce vibrations.
